Avatar for the PrefectHQ user
PrefectHQ
prefect
BlogDocsChangelog

Fix websocket timeout when watching long-running flow runs

#20590
Comparing
devin/1770412331-fix-websocket-timeout-watching
(
5510e81
) with
main
(
5887684
)
CodSpeed Performance Gauge
0%
Untouched
2
Ignored
6

Benchmarks

8 total
bench_task_decorator
benches/bench_tasks.py
CodSpeed Performance Gauge
0%
550.5 µs549.6 µs
bench_import_prefect_flow
benches/bench_import.py
CodSpeed Performance Gauge
0%
1.4 s1.4 s
bench_import_prefect
benches/bench_import.py
Ignored
CodSpeed Performance Gauge
0%
1.1 s1.1 s
bench_flow_call[options1]
benches/bench_flows.py
Ignored
CodSpeed Performance Gauge
0%
106.7 ms107.2 ms
bench_flow_call[options0]
benches/bench_flows.py
Ignored
CodSpeed Performance Gauge
+11%
116.3 ms105.1 ms
bench_flow_decorator
benches/bench_flows.py
Ignored
CodSpeed Performance Gauge
-14%
4.9 ms5.7 ms
bench_task_call
benches/bench_tasks.py
Ignored
CodSpeed Performance Gauge
-6%
6.8 ms7.2 ms
bench_task_submit
benches/bench_tasks.py
Ignored
CodSpeed Performance Gauge
-95%
4.8 ms92.1 ms

Commits

Click on a commit to change the comparison range
Base
main
5887684
+0.14%
Fix websocket timeout when watching long-running flow runs
b234c47
19 hours ago
by devin-ai-integration[bot]
-0.34%
Add test coverage for websocket reconnection in wait_for_flow_run
9471c95
18 hours ago
by devin-ai-integration[bot]
+0.16%
Move websocket timeout fix into PrefectEventSubscriber
71b9622
17 hours ago
by devin-ai-integration[bot]
+0.16%
Add retry loop in wait_for_flow_run as defense-in-depth
5510e81
11 hours ago
by devin-ai-integration[bot]
© 2026 CodSpeed Technology
Home Terms Privacy Docs